House raising services involve elevating an existing structure above potential flood levels or other ground-related hazards. This process typically includes carefully lifting the entire building, often using specialized equipment, and then placing it on a new, higher foundation. The goal is to protect homes from flood damage, reduce insurance costs, and comply with local regulations in flood-prone areas. These services require precise planning and execution to ensure the stability and safety of the structure during and after the lift.
Many homeowners turn to house raising to address issues caused by flooding, rising water levels, or previous flood damage. It can also be a solution for properties located on uneven or unstable ground, where traditional foundations may not be suitable. By elevating a home, property owners can prevent future water intrusion, minimize repair costs, and preserve the property's value. This service is especially relevant in regions with frequent heavy rainfall or areas prone to flooding.
The types of properties that typically utilize house raising services include single-family homes, historic houses, and even some multi-unit buildings. Older homes, especially those built before modern floodplain regulations, often require elevation to meet current standards. Commercial buildings and structures with basements that are susceptible to water intrusion may also benefit from raising. In general, any property situated in a flood zone or on land with unstable soil can be a candidate for this service.

Discover typical House Raising project ranges for Union, KY.
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$30,000 and $80,000 for a standard single-story home. Larger or more complex projects can exceed $100,000 depending on the scope and location.
Factors Affecting Cost - Expenses vary based on home size, foundation type, and the extent of structural modifications needed. For example, a small home may cost around $30,000, while a larger, multi-story residence could reach $100,000 or more.
Average Price Breakdown - The average cost for house raising in the Union, KY area is approximately $50,000 to $70,000. This includes labor, equipment, and preliminary assessments, but prices may differ among local service providers.
Additional Expenses - Costs may increase if foundation repairs, utility relocations, or site cleanup are required. These extras can add several thousand dollars to the overall project budget, depending on the specific needs.
